Re: Other Championship Clubs : Sun May 05, 2024 4:26 pm  
Law was given a tough time by Sau first half for sure, but fair play to him he stuck to his task well, was helped in the second half by the back row (12) moving out wider to add extra cover. Ran a lovely line and burst onto a short pass for his try
Lawford, I thought, in the first half when Keighley went in front, got frustrated at times, was worrying seeing him head for the sidelines holding his arm but thankfully it appears to have just been a stinger which he shook off and stayed on, had a better 2nd half, backed a break up well and made good meters, put in a beautiful diagonal kick for the last try.
Shaw got through a lot of tackles, and did his fair share of carries, didn't really make that many meters, but he took a lot of his carries from out of the 20m and into a very aggressive Keighley defence against much bigger and more experienced opponents.
Thoroughly enjoyable game to watch
